共 1 篇文章

标签:简单教程:如何在Linux下使用C语言编写启动程序? (linux c 启动程序)

简单教程:如何在Linux下使用C语言编写启动程序? (linux c 启动程序)

Linux是一种开放源代码的操作系统,拥有广泛的用户群体,包括公司、学生和开发人员等等。其中,许多开发人员使用C语言来编写他们的程序,因为C语言是一种高效而稳定的语言。在Linux系统中,我们可以使用C语言编写启动程序,以便在系统启动时自动运行我们的程序。下面将介绍如何在Linux下使用C语言编写启动程序。 之一步:安装必要工具 在编写启动程序之前,您需要安装必要的工具,这些工具可以帮助您编写和编译C语言程序。在Linux系统中,您可以使用以下命令来安装这些工具: “` sudo apt-get update sudo apt-get install build-essential “` 这些命令将安uild-essential包,其中包含了gcc编译器和其他必要的工具。 第二步:创建C语言程序 接下来,您需要创建一个C语言程序。您可以使用任何文本编辑器(如vi、nano等)来创建程序。下面是一个简单的示例程序: “` #include int mn(int argc, char *argv[]) { printf(“Hello World!\n”); return 0; } “` 此程序将输出“Hello World!”。 第三步:编译C语言程序 一旦您创建了C语言程序,就可以使用以下命令来编译它: “` gcc -o .c “` 例如,如果您的输入文件名为“test.c”,输出文件名为“test”,则您可以使用以下命令来编译该程序: “` gcc -o test test.c “` 此命令将生成一个名称为“test”的可执行文件,该文件可作为启动程序。 第四步:将程序添加到系统启动项 完成程序编译后,您需要将其添加到系统启动项中。要实现这一点,您需要编辑/etc/rc.local文件。该文件包含在系统启动时自动运行的所有命令。在该文件的末尾添加以下命令: “` ./ “` 其中,是您的可执行文件的路径。 例如,如果您的可执行文件位于/home/user/test目录下,则应在文件的末尾添加以下命令: “` /home/user/test/test “` 保存并关闭文件后,您的程序将在系统启动时自动运行。 相关问题拓展阅读: 怎么用Linux运行C程序? 如何在linux下编译,执行c程序 怎么用Linux运行C程序? 不一定非要用vi 编辑器 那个很不方便(个人观点) 可以使用gedit geany emacs 等等 比如编写枣则亮好了一个文件test.c 使用gcc /g++ -o test test.c进行编译 有很多凳宽盯物编译选项你自己看着加 编译完成后执行 ./test 就可以运行了 如何在linux下编译,执行c程序 1.编译单个源文件 在屏幕上打印”Hello,Linux.” #include #include int main(int argc,char **argv){printf(“Hello,Linux.\n”);exit(0);}将源文件保存为hello.c,开始进行编译 $gcc -o hello hello.c 编译成功完成后,在当前路径下,生成一个名为hello的文件,然后执行 $./hello在屏幕上,你将会看到打印结果:Hello,Linux. 说明:在默认情况下,编译成漏隐腔功完成后,会在当前路径下,生成一个名为a.out的文件,然后执行$./a.out便可打印结果,但通常可以通过选项-o来指定自己的可执行程序名称; 2.编译多个源文件 3.使用外部函数库 linux c 启动程序的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于linux c 启动程序,简单教程:如何在Linux下使用C语言编写启动程序?,怎么用Linux运行C程序?,如何在linux下编译,执行c程序的信息别忘了在本站进行查找喔。

技术分享